So I just got fiber optic internet installed. The wifi works fine for the fiber modem. My ethernet however, is unidentified and cannot establish a connection no matter what I do.
Is the Cat5e cable not good enough for the fiber internet, do I need a better one? I have 3 different ethernet cables and they all come to the same problem, they work perfectly fine on my modem with the normal internet but will have the error when I tried to use the fiber optic internet modem. "Unidentified Network" on the adapter and error being "Ethernet does not have a valid IP configuration" when troubleshooting. The Ethernet green light on the modem is on as well "Ethernet 1" . I tried everything on this site as well and nothing worked https://www.bouncegeek.com/unidentified-network-ethernet-windows-10/. Does anybody have a solution. Is it just that I need a better ethernet cable for the fiber modem?

ISP: Bahamas Telephone Company
Modem/Router: Calix 844G-1

Connection path: ISP >> Fiber-Modem >> Ethernet Cable >> PC

Cat5e is plenty for fiber. My guess is the router/modem isn't setup for the Ethernet to give an IP address.

Right now you aren't getting an IP address on your connection with the Ethernet cable. My best guess is the WiFi is setup for access but the Ethernet side isn't.

Only one network adapter either wired or wireless should be enabled. Not both at the same and not two of any network adapters barring special requirements.

Disable the Qualcomm wireless network adapter leaving the Intel wired network adapter enabled.

Disable IPv6

On the modem/router change the lease time to more than 24 hours.

Change the DNS Servers to 8.8.8.8 and 8.8.4.4 (Google).
